Order and group by sql
WebMar 25, 2024 · GROUP BY and ORDER BY Explained The purpose of the ORDER BY clause is to sort the query result by one or more columns. Meanwhile, the GROUP BY clause is used … WebJan 18, 2024 · Use the ORDER BY clause to display the output table of a query in either ascending or descending alphabetical order. Whereas the GROUP BY clause gathers rows …
Order and group by sql
Did you know?
WebThe GROUP BY clause allows you to group rows based on values of one or more columns. It returns one row for each group. The following shows the basic syntax of the GROUP BY clause: SELECT column1, column2, aggregate_function (column3) FROM table_name GROUP BY column1, column2; Code language: SQL (Structured Query Language) (sql) WebFeb 28, 2024 · GROUP BY CUBE creates groups for all possible combinations of columns. For GROUP BY CUBE (a, b) the results has groups for unique values of (a, b), (NULL, b), (a, …
Web1 day ago · One option is to look at the problem as if it were gaps and islands, i.e. put certain rows into groups (islands) and then extract data you need. Sample data: WebMay 17, 2024 · The order of execution is as follows: WHERE – GROUP BY – HAVING. This also means WHERE is written before GROUP BY, while HAVING comes after GROUP BY. In practice, WHERE filters data first. This filtered data will be grouped and aggregated, and then HAVING will filter the grouped and aggregated data.
WebThe SQL Grouping_ID () is the SQL function which is used to compute the level of grouping. It can only be used with SELECT statement, HAVING clause, or ORDERED BY clause when GROUP BY is specified. The GROUPING_ID () function returns an integer bitmap with the lowest N bits illuminated. A illuminated bit indicates that the corresponding ... WebPeople generally use the GROUP BY clause when they need to aggregate the available functions to multiple sets of rows. On the other hand, we use the ORDER BY clause when …
WebApr 14, 2024 · mysql中的order by和group by是两个常用的查询语句。 order by用于对查询结果进行排序,可以按照一个或多个字段进行排序,可以指定升序或降序排列。 group by用于对查询结果进行分组,可以按照一个或多个字段进行分组,然后对每个组进行聚合计算,如求 …
WebSQL Group By vs Order By - In SQL, we have two common clauses that help us sort the data: Group By and Order By. phoenix tv show spin offWebThe GROUP BY statement is often used with aggregate functions ( COUNT (), MAX (), MIN (), SUM (), AVG ()) to group the result-set by one or more columns. GROUP BY Syntax … phoenix tv football todayWeb6 rows · Apr 22, 2024 · GROUP BY ORDER BY; 1. Group by statement is used to group the rows that have the same value. ... phoenix tutor of achillesWebMar 25, 2024 · In this post, we will understand the difference between group by and order by in SQL. GROUP BY It is used to group the rows which have the same value. It can be used in CREATE VIEW statement. In select statement, it has to be used before the ‘ORDER BY’ keyword. Attribute can’t be in a ‘GROUP BY’ statement when it is under aggregate function. phoenix tv channel 12 coffee mugsWebApr 11, 2024 · 可以使用spark sql中的窗口函数来实现sql中的group by后取组内top n。具体步骤如下: 1. 使用spark sql中的窗口函数row_number()来为每个分组内的记录编号,按照需要排序的字段进行排序。 2. 将每个分组内的记录按照row_number()的编号进行筛选,选取前n条记录作为top n。 3. phoenix tutoring hurstvilleWebApr 11, 2024 · MySQL的排序有两种方式:. Using filesort :通过表的索引或全表扫描,读取满足条件的数据行,然后在排序缓冲区sort buffer中完成排序操作,所有不是通过索引直 … ttss dashboardWebSorted by: 5 You must put GROUP BY before ORDER BY. Take a look at SOQL SELECT Syntax: SELECT fieldList [subquery] [...] [TYPEOF typeOfField whenExpression [...] elseExpression END] [...] FROM objectType [,...] [USING SCOPE filterScope] [ WHERE conditionExpression] [WITH [DATA CATEGORY] filteringExpression] tts seating